An Authentic Day Out in Kerala’s Hills from Coimbatore

This 12-hour tour sets out early from Coimbatore, with a convenient pickup at either Vivanta Coimbatore or your designated location. From there, the journey immediately immerses you in the scenic charm of the Western Ghats, winding through hills blanketed in tea plantations. The drive itself is a treat, with lush greenery and mountain vistas that keep your camera busy.

What the Day Looks Like
Once in Mankulam, the tranquil eco-village near Munnar, the day unfolds with stops that are both visually stunning and culturally enriching. The first major highlight is visiting Lakkam and Viripara Waterfalls. These spots are perfect for stretching your legs and capturing the beauty of cascading water amid thick greenery. Travelers report that the waterfalls are “pristine,” and “perfect for a quick nature escape,” despite some noting that the best views depend on recent rainfall.
The Jeep Safari Experience
The jeep safari through forest routes is often described as a “thrilling” part of the tour. It’s an open-air adventure that offers glimpses of elephants, streams, and dense jungle vegetation. According to reviews, guides are knowledgeable, and the safari provides a genuine sense of adventure. One traveler shared that they saw wild elephants nearby, which added a memorable wildlife encounter. The bumpy, off-road ride is a fun way to explore areas less accessible by foot, giving you a closer look at Kerala’s natural habitat.
Exploring Spice Gardens and Village Life
Walking through spice plantations is another key feature. You’ll see cardamom, pepper, and other aromatic spices growing in scenic fields, with guides explaining their uses and significance. Many visitors find these visits “informative and fragrant,” and appreciate the chance to interact with local villagers, gaining insight into traditional lifestyles.

The tour includes a local Kerala-style lunch set in a serene hilltop or garden setting. The menu often features rice, fish, vegetable curries, and traditional accompaniments. Reviewers mention the meal as “simple, tasty, and satisfying,” perfect for recharging after a morning of activities. Eating amidst the natural surroundings enhances the experience, making it more than just a stop for refueling.
Optional Nature Walks and River Relaxation
Post-lunch, you might enjoy short nature walks along forest trails or relaxing by the Panniyar River. These moments allow for peaceful contemplation, photography, or just soaking in the pure mountain air. Given the reviews, travelers tend to leave feeling rejuvenated and inspired by the untouched landscape.

What You Need to Know Before You Go

- The tour lasts approximately 12 hours, so a full day commitment.
- Pickup times are flexible depending on availability, with options at Vivanta Coimbatore or other locations.
- The experience is guided in English, ensuring easy communication.
- The trip is priced to include transport, activities, and meals, making it a hassle-free way to explore.
- Weather can impact waterfalls and outdoor activities, so check the forecast and be prepared for rain or sun.
- The group size is private, which supports a more tailored experience and prompt service.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is this tour suitable for children?
Yes, this day trip can be enjoyed by families, especially those who appreciate outdoor activities and scenic drives. Keep in mind that the jeep safari can be bumpy, so younger children should be comfortable with off-road rides.
What should I wear for this trip?
Comfortable clothing suitable for outdoor activities, including sturdy shoes for walking and exploring the waterfalls and plantations, is advised. Also, consider bringing a raincoat or umbrella if weather forecasts predict rain.
How long is the jeep safari?
The safari is part of the day’s activities, offering a thrilling way to see the forested areas. While the exact duration isn’t specified, reviews note it’s an exciting, bumpy ride that provides close encounters with wildlife and dense jungle scenery.
What does the lunch include?
The included Kerala-style meal typically features rice, vegetables, fish, and traditional accompaniments. It’s simple but flavorful, designed to replenish energy after morning adventures.
Are there any additional costs?
No, the tour covers transport, activities, and lunch as per the package. Extra expenses might include souvenirs or additional drinks, but the core experience is all-inclusive.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, free cancellation is available up to 24 hours in advance, allowing flexibility in your travel plans.
